概括
几乎一半的运动教练 (AT) 在没有明确的指导方针的情况下,在脑震荡后管理了医疗取消资格 (MDQ) 案件. 对于这些复杂的决定,ATs考虑了各种因素,如运动,脑震荡史和学术人员.

背景情况:
- 脑震荡后的医疗失格 (MDQ) 是一个重大的临床挑战,因为缺乏基于证据的指导.
- 运动教练 (AT) 在大学环境中经常遇到这些复杂的决策.
研究的目的:
- 为了记录AT的经验与MDQ脑震荡后的经验.
- 了解AT对MDQ决策的看法.
- 探讨AT认为对脑震荡后的MDQ过程至关重要的因素.
主要方法:
- 一种混合方法的方法,将在线横截面调查与半结构面试相结合.
- 从413名大学体育教练 (AT) 收集的调查数据.
- 对20名涉及MDQ案件的AT进行了后续采访.
主要成果:
- 大约49%的接受调查的AT报告说,他们参与了至少一个脑震荡后的MDQ病例.
- 参与MDQ病例的AT平均管理了2.3个病例.
- 影响MDQ决策的关键因素包括运动类型,脑震荡史,康复状态,生活质量和学业表现.
结论:
- 很大一部分AT在脑震荡后的MDQ决策中没有建立的指导方针.
- 考虑了整体的患者幸福感,并纳入了超越直接伤害的各种因素.
- 需要进一步的研究,以制定基于证据的建议,为AT管理与脑震荡相关的MDQ.
